PART 2. DEFINING THE DIFFERENT PARTS OF YOUR STORY

STEP 1: AT THE BEGINNING

Instructions Hints Your IdeasWHO? Imagine a few other characters Name/age/

personality

WHEN? Imagine the moment when the scene took place

- in the morning/afternoon/evening…

Page 4: The Competition Of The Month

- in spring/summer/autumn/winter- in 2006…- the day before yesterday…- a couple of weeks ago- …

WHERE?

Imagine the place where the scene(s) took place

- at school- in the forest- in a castle- In the Highlands- …

Write a precise description of the place where the scene took place. Use the past tense!!!

WHAT? What was happening? - what was your main character doing?- what were the minor characters doing?

STEP 2: AT THE END

Now imagine the last sentence of your short story. “He died” or “they married and had a lot of children” are too common!!!

STEP 3: SUDDENLY…

Your character was doing something special when suddenly something unexpected happened. Imagine what it could be.
